Living in our world and culture, being bombarded by images of the "ideal" body every day, it is no surprise there is a rise in body image insecurities and disordered eating patterns. Finding ease and contentment in your own body can be a painful struggle, but it is possible. Therapy can help you unpack the familial, social and systemic influences contributing to negative body image and self-worth, creating a path towards healing and the freedom to live in harmony with your authentic self.
